The Good
- Real-Time Interaction: Players can engage with real dealers through live video feeds, creating a social environment similar to that of physical casinos.
- Transparency: Live dealer games are generally more transparent than traditional online games. You can see the cards being dealt or the roulette wheel spinning in real-time.
- Variety of Games: Many online casinos offer a wide range of live dealer games, including blackjack, roulette, and baccarat, catering to different preferences.
- Safety Measures: Reputable casinos often employ strong security protocols to protect player data, enhancing overall safety.
The Bad
- Higher House Edge: Live dealer games can have a higher house edge compared to RNG games. For example, the RTP (Return to Player) for live blackjack may be around 99.3%, while RNG versions can reach up to 99.5%.
- Wagering Requirements: Bonuses for live dealer games often come with strict wagering requirements, typically around 35x, making it challenging to cash out winnings.
- Limited Table Limits: Live dealer games usually have higher minimum bets compared to their RNG counterparts, which can be prohibitive for casual players.
The Ugly
- Potential for Scams: Not all online casinos are licensed or regulated. Always verify the casino’s licensing status to ensure you are playing in a safe environment.
- Connection Issues: Live streaming requires a stable internet connection. Connection issues can lead to interruptions, potentially affecting your gameplay experience.
- Player Behavior: The social aspect can sometimes lead to negative interactions. Be prepared for unsavory behavior from other players or dealers.
